New Delhi: Indian handset-maker Xolo has launched a new smartphone One HD in India. The phone has been launched in the affordable segment. It comes at Rs 4,777.

The smartphone is exclusively available on e-commerse portal Amazon. The registrations for the sale began yesterday and will be on till midnight today.

Xolo One comes with a 5 inch HD display with 280x720 pixel resolution and is powered by 1.3GHz quad-core processor.

The device packs 1GB RAM with 8GB of onboard storage (extension up to 32GB via microSD card) and runs on Android 5.0.1 version.

This new Xolo model sports 8 megapixel primary camera with LED flash and 5 megapixel front camera for selfies that too with LED flash along with an OmniVision BSI-2 sensor inside the camera.

The dual SIM Xolo One HD has a battery capacity of 2300mAh and supports 3G, Bluetooth 4.0, GPS and WiFi connectivity.
